On Mon,  9 Sep 2024 15:34:31 -0700 you wrote:
> llvm change [1] made a change such that __sync_fetch_and_{and,or,xor}()
> will generate atomic_fetch_*() insns even if the return value is not used.
> This is a deliberate choice to make sure barrier semantics are preserved
> from source code to asm insn.
> 
> But the change in [1] caused arena_atomics selftest failure.
